Monster Hunter Wilds, the latest action RPG from Capcom, was showcased during PlayStation’s latest State of Play event. The game is set to release in 2025 for PlayStation 5, Xbox Series X|S, and PC via Steam. In this game, players will join a special team of the Research Commission to explore the Forbidden Lands. This marks the first time in the series where hunters will face the unknown alongside their companions.

The ecosystems in Monster Hunter Wilds are home to a variety of wildlife adapted to their environmental context. From smaller monsters like the Dalthydon to larger ones like the Doshaguma and Chatacabra, players will encounter a diverse range of creatures. The gameplay introduces new features such as Seikret, rideable creatures that allow for seamless transitions from story to gameplay and traversal of vast environments.

Players will also have access to all 14 iconic weapon types from the series, each evolved with new actions. Precision Mode offers finer control over aiming, while the Hook Slingshot provides additional abilities and the ability to pick up items from a distance. Those who connect their Monster Hunter: World save data will receive bonus items in Monster Hunter Wilds, further enhancing their gaming experience.
